Kikuyugrass is a prostrate perennial grass that grows finest below amazing to heat temperatures (60° to ninety°F) and moist problems. It grows rapidly all through periods of substantial light intensity and heat temperatures but also maintains continuous advancement at cooler temperatures. When rising rapidly, kikuyugrass is capable of exceeding 1 inch each day. Flowering begins in late spring and it is stimulated by mowing. Seed manufacturing continues throughout summer and fall. Kikuyugrass spreads by creating a network of thick, fleshy stems.

Examine all herbicide labels. Learn regardless of whether you're implementing a selective or nonselective herbicide. Given that selective herbicides concentrate on a particular variety of weed, it is possible to apply them additional liberally. Nonselective herbicides will eliminate any plant; so utilize these carefully and only to plants you ought to destroy.
